Most companies cannot fill cyber roles leaving large gaps in defense




  • Cisco surveyed 8,000 security leaders and companies for a new report
  • Most companies suffered an AI attack last year
  • Filling cybersecurity roles seems to be a great challenge

Most companies cannot occupy vacant roles for cybersecurity professionals, leaving great gaps in their defenses that threat actors can easily exploit. These are some of the findings resonated in the cybersecurity preparation index 2025, a report recently published by Cisco networks giants.

The document was written based on a double blind survey of 8,000 private sector security leaders and business leaders in 30 global markets. In it, Cisco said that almost nine out of ten (86%) of respondents identified the shortage of qualified cybersecurity professionals as an “important challenge.” In addition, it was said that more than half of the respondents reported having more than ten vacancies.
